BIO
Mora's birth name is Jamal Willie Morant. Jamal was born at Woodhull Medical and Mental health center located in the city of Brooklyn, New York. At 1052am Tot Olinda Miller received her second child and first from Jamal's father Willie Morant. Jamal grew up in an apartment with his grandma Janice Morant. While living with his grandma Jamal was enrolled in PS115 were he put in two years of his life to elementary school. As Jamal attended school his mother who was fed up with the crime rate in Brooklyn decided that it was time to move. Tot told Jamal's father Willie to find a house out in the south and he found a home in the city of Columbia, South Carolina. Jamal put in his two years in at 7 oaks elementary located in the heart of Columbia to hit Marietta, Georgia at age 10. A year later something detrimental happen to Jamal change his life. His parents went there seperate ways which left his mother to be the only income for the family. To past time Jamal played football his local school area. At age 16 another detrimental event occurred in his life which brought his family to a new low. His older brother Gamal Miller was sentence to 5 years in prison for possession of a deadly weapon, robbery, and breaking and entering. With no masculinant figures in his life Jamal then grew into roll which provided such concerns. He began fighting with his mother constantly. Fighting with his mother forced him to moved out of his house at age 17. Once he moved out he enrolled himself into Georgia Perimeter College which after a semester he dropped out. At the time he dropped out was born his first son Nicholas Morant. The next year Jamal picked up a second job as a punch operator in a warehouse while already working at UPS starting it his previous year. There he had a pen, pad, and a really good friend by the name of Brian Jackson. Their him and Brian wrote day by day aspiring to make a group called Urban Currency. The group consisted of four members: James Swearengin, Brian Jackson, Lawrence Bynum, and Jamal Morant. From there they recorded daily to ultimately achieve a album called "What We Stand For," but as there is in every group, comes bumps in the road. Lawrence went to the military, Brian took a different career route, and James started Isso productions. Feeling like it was his best oppurtunity to better his dream Jamal decided that music was the route to go. He then collabed with James to create "Don't Know, Get Low" as his first hit single released in Febuary 2009. Jamal is currently working on a mixtape called "The Versatile" which should premiered in March 2010.
